1) On the day of the successful operation to remove (and kill) the head of ISIS, it should have been Trump's time to shine. 

That ISIS leader was a monster named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, and who some of us remember was responsible for the beheadings of innocents, throwing homosexuals off cliffs, slaughtering Christians and other religious minorities, and burning alive a Jordanian pilot. The world is clearly better without him.

Yet on that same day, at a World Series home game in DC between the Washington Nationals and the Houston Astros, Trump heard the "Lock Him Up" chant from the crowd there.

Karma for all the "Lock Her Up?" chants at his rallies? Good clean fun?

Similarly, the "he died like a dog" (referring to al-Baghdadi) line was probably meant to humiliate and dissuade all ISIS and al-Qaeda wannabes probably didn't go over as well as him honoring a real dog, which was the K-9 dog injured in that raid (the only casualty).

So some of us were thrilled that Trump and his generals (and MOST importantly the Special Forces heroes) worked with the local powers to take this monster out...but wondered if the phraseology could have been altered to something like "he died like he lived, like a coward, and even made his small children to die with him when he realized he couldn't use them as human shields."

There were plenty of ways that the President could have allowed his political victory (and, more importantly, the victory to both the West and the World) to extend beyond his fan base.
